Principle of AH horizontal cntrifugal slurry pump is the same to Warman slurry pump.
This pump is applied in industry of transporting intensity, abrasion, corrosion, high concentrations of liquid, like metallurgy, mining, coal, electricity and building materials industries.
Slurry pump series could be taken used in multistage series. According to the different nature of the ore, high-chromium alloy, corrosion resisting rubber, and stainless steel material lining could be increased.
